Abstract
Conventional and Sharia banks in Indonesia have different potential bankruptcy risks. This research aims to examine the potential bankruptcy risks in the Indonesian banking sector, with a focus on the comparison between Sharia and conventional banks. The study adopts a literature review approach by comparing the financial ratios of both types of banks. The research results are expected to provide an understanding of the differences in bankruptcy risk characteristics between Sharia and conventional banks in Indonesia. This will provide a foundation for regulators, bank management, and other stakeholders to take appropriate steps in mitigating bankruptcy risks, including the implementation of green economic strategies.
